Abstract

The invention relates to a money checking method and system. The method comprises the following steps: converting a UV image of paper money into a binary image; inquiring a maximum value position column I in binary image column projection, and substituting first pixels in the maximum value position column I with second pixels; circularly inquiring a maximum value position column II in the binary image column projection within a preset inquiring frequency threshold value, and substituting first pixels in the maximum value position column II with second pixels if the quantity of the first pixels is greater than a quantity threshold value, wherein the maximum value position column I is a position column with the projection in a magnetic safety line set zone line being a maximum value; the maximum value position column II is a position column with the projection within preset zones on the two sides of the maximum value position column I being a maximum value. By locking possible zones of a magnetic safety line, the system reduces calculated amount, reduces calculation difficulty and the error rate, solves the problem of the interference of splicing traces, and improves the accuracy.

Description

technical field [0001] The invention belongs to the field of banknote processing, and in particular relates to a banknote checking method and system. Background technique [0002] In the existing technology, ultraviolet (UV) identification is carried out on banknotes, because splicing marks will appear when the banknotes are damaged, and the position of the magnetic security thread of the banknotes is often not fixed, and the magnetic properties of banknotes of different issuance versions are different. The width of the security line is also inconsistent. The above factors will affect the banknote recognition. Moreover, it cannot be shielded directly with a template. Usually, the UV image is converted into a binary image. Each pixel in the binary image is either a black pixel or a white pixel. It is an image with no intermediate transition in the gray value.
